如何安全地管理和使用ClientKey?

作者:铜川麻将开发公司 阅读:50 次 发布时间:2023-07-03 18:42:19

摘要:近年来,随着互联网的快速发展与普及,越来越多的应用、网站、软件都开始采用HTTPS协议保护用户的隐私安全。而客户端秘钥(ClientKey)则是HTTPS协议中一个重要的组成部分。ClientKey的安全性与保密性,对于用户数据的安全以及系统服务的可靠性都有着至关重要的作用。在本文中...

近年来,随着互联网的快速发展与普及,越来越多的应用、网站、软件都开始采用HTTPS协议保护用户的隐私安全。而客户端秘钥(ClientKey)则是HTTPS协议中一个重要的组成部分。ClientKey的安全性与保密性,对于用户数据的安全以及系统服务的可靠性都有着至关重要的作用。在本文中,我们将介绍如何安全地管理并使用ClientKey。

如何安全地管理和使用ClientKey?

1. 什么是ClientKey

首先,我们需要明确什么是ClientKey。ClientKey,也可以称之为客户端私钥,是一种可用于数据加密和解密的密钥,它在HTTPS协议中,负责确保数据在传输过程中的安全性和完整性。 在进行HTTPS请求时,客户端和服务端使用ClientKey和ServerKey,进行公钥和私钥的交换,从而建立起一条安全的通信链路。

2. ClientKey的重要性

在传输过程中,如果客户端密钥泄漏,则恶意攻击者就可以利用该密钥解密和篡改传输数据。因此,ClientKey的保密性对于数据安全具有重要意义。同时,ClientKey的完整性必须得到保障,否则也容易造成篡改、窃取等恶意行为。

3. ClientKey的管理

接下来,我们将介绍如何安全地管理ClientKey:

(1)尽量使用硬件保护:如果可能的话,建议使用安全的硬件设备来存储ClientKey,例如使用基于智能卡或加密USB设备等硬件。选择这些硬件存储设备可以有效地增加ClientKey的安全性和保密性。使用这些硬件设备时应该注意保留相应的密码( PIN) 或生物识别认证确保使用权限来源的可靠性。

(2)定期更新ClientKey:对于ClientKey,我们还应该定期进行更新,以增加系统保密性和难以破解性。定期更新ClientKey可以防止密钥被盗用或被不良元素破解。

(3)限制管理权限:限制用户权限可以减少篡改密钥或滥用权限的风险。只有有关人员可以进行ClientKey的访问,而且需要经过身份认证和授权,以确保安全性。

(4)合理组织ClientKey:合理组织ClientKey可以减少数据泄漏或丢失的风险。例如,将ClientKey存储在一个可以同时控制密钥范围粒度、限制访问权限的统一密钥管理系统(KMS)中,可以更好地保护密钥安全及管理。

4. ClientKey的使用

使用ClientKey可以提供安全、加密通信和数据的完整性和一致性。以下是一些使用ClientKey的最佳实践:

(1)将密钥长度设置为最佳长度,这通常是2048位或更长的位数,这可以增加加密强度,并使密钥难以破解。

(2)使用合适的证书:在建立加密通信时,需要使用签名证书来验证与之通信的主机身份。选择可信的证书颁发机构(CA),以及适合的证书类型(如域名证书、组织证书等),可以减少安全隐患。

(3)定期轮换密钥或证书:轮换密钥或证书是一种保护数据安全和提高系统安全性的有效措施。为了避免密钥或证书已经被泄露或破解,经常更换或轮换密钥或证书才是保证数据安全和系统安全性的有效措施。

5. 结论

综上所述,ClientKey的安全性和保密性对于保护数据的安全和可靠性非常重要。我们必须采取多种措施来防止ClientKey泄漏,例如使用安全的硬件设备、定期更换密码并减少授权权限等。此外,合理组织ClientKey以及使用最佳实践也是确保数据传输安全的重要措施。通过上述方法的实施,我们可以更好地管理和使用ClientKey,以保护用户数据安全。

  • 原标题:如何安全地管理和使用ClientKey?

  • 本文链接:https:////zxzx/22539.html

  • 本文由深圳飞扬众网小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与飞扬众网联系删除。
  • 微信二维码

    CTAPP999

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:166-2096-5058


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部